MarineMax's Latest Earnings Overview

MarineMax Incorporated (NYSE: HZO), recognized as the largest recreational boat and yacht retailer in the nation, recently conducted its Fiscal 2024 Fourth Quarter and Full Year Conference Call. During this call, CEO Brett McGill and CFO Mike McLamb delivered insights regarding the company's financial performance amidst the challenges posed by Hurricanes Helene and Milton. Despite these adversities, MarineMax showcased a 2% uptick in annual revenue, achieving $2.4 billion.

However, the fourth-quarter revenue exhibited a 5% downturn, largely influenced by the hurricanes and disruptions in the insurance market. The company maintained robust gross margins at 34%, largely due to its high-margin operations, coupled with a reduction in SG&A expenses exceeding $5 million.

Significant Takeaways

The recent earnings call brought forth key points regarding MarineMax's performance:

  • The annual revenue rose by 2% to $2.4 billion, paired with a 1% increase in comparable store sales.
  • Fourth-quarter revenue faced a 5% decline, attributed to the impact of hurricanes and market challenges.
  • Despite this, gross margins stood strong at 34%, while SG&A expenses reduced by over $5 million.
  • MarineMax successfully acquired the Aviara brand and celebrated noteworthy milestones from IGY marinas.
  • For Fiscal 2025, the guidance anticipates adjusted EBITDA to range between $150 million and $180 million, and adjusted net income per diluted share projected between $1.80 and $2.80.

Company Direction Moving Forward

Looking ahead, management projects stable same-store sales and consolidated margins remaining in the low 30s for fiscal 2025. Here’s what to expect:

  • Adjusted EBITDA is forecasted to fall between $150 million and $180 million.
  • Anticipated adjusted net income per diluted share is expected to be between $1.80 and $2.80.
  • It's important for the company to recover from storm damage, particularly in vulnerable markets.

Challenges Ahead

Despite some positive indicators, certain bearish highlights emerged:

  • The hurricanes are expected to disrupt business through the December quarter, leading to negative comparisons to the previous year.
  • Inventory levels remain high, however, manufacturers are working to assist dealers.
  • Increased promotional efforts may ensue as businesses aim to alleviate inventory excess.

Positive Indicators

On a brighter note, several bullish highlights were noted:

  • Year-over-year retail financing rates have decreased, fostering better customer purchases.
  • Consumer enthusiasm for boating remains high, even in the face of challenging market dynamics.
  • The management team is investigating potential mergers and acquisitions, especially within marina and superyacht markets.

Operational Adjustments

The company aims to maintain or reduce inventory levels year-over-year and anticipates annualized SG&A cuts between $20 million and $25 million. MarineMax takes an optimistic stance on recovery from the storm impact and acknowledges the positive customer turnout at events like the Fort Lauderdale Boat Show.

Strategic Insights

The recent fiscal year, characterized by natural disasters, displayed MarineMax's resilience, maintaining solid gross margins while implementing strategic movements for long-term growth. The acquisition of the Aviara brand signifies their commitment and adaptability in diversifying operations.

MarineMax's Financial Position and Expectations

As of the end of the recent fiscal year, MarineMax reported cash and cash equivalents exceeding $224 million and inventory levels elevated due to the impacts of Hurricane Helene. Despite slight declines in gross profit, the company’s ability to adapt through acquisitions and strategic growth positions it well for recovery.
